aboutsummaryrefslogtreecommitdiffstats
path: root/src/qmlcompiler/qqmljsscope_p.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/qmlcompiler/qqmljsscope_p.h')
-rw-r--r--src/qmlcompiler/qqmljsscope_p.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/qmlcompiler/qqmljsscope_p.h b/src/qmlcompiler/qqmljsscope_p.h
index 8f095cffbf..cbfc109154 100644
--- a/src/qmlcompiler/qqmljsscope_p.h
+++ b/src/qmlcompiler/qqmljsscope_p.h
@@ -96,7 +96,8 @@ public:
JSLexicalScope,
QMLScope,
GroupedPropertyScope,
- AttachedPropertyScope
+ AttachedPropertyScope,
+ EnumScope
};
enum class AccessSemantics {
@@ -260,7 +261,8 @@ public:
return result;
}
- void resolveTypes(const QHash<QString, ConstPtr> &contextualTypes);
+ static void resolveTypes(const QQmlJSScope::Ptr &self,
+ const QHash<QString, ConstPtr> &contextualTypes);
void setSourceLocation(const QQmlJS::SourceLocation &sourceLocation)
{